Analysis

Peru recorded 9.1% for adequacy of benefits in 4th quintile (%) -all social protection and in 2022.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 17.5% on the previous year and down 7.3% over ten years.

Over the whole period, adequacy of benefits in 4th quintile (%) -all social protection and in Peru peaked at 15.3% in 2020 and was at its lowest, 8.5%, in 2014.

That places Peru 30th out of 36 countries with data for 2022, putting it in the bottom qu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 15 years of available data.
